Movie Overview: Killing Salazar
| Movie | Killing Salazar |
| Release Year | 2017 |
| Director | Keoni Waxman |
| Genre | Crime / Action / Adventure / Thriller |
| Runtime | 100 minutes (1h 40m) |
| Language | EN |

What Happens at the End of Killing Salazar?
An elite team of DEA agents are assigned to protect a dangerous drug lord and take refuge in a luxury hotel while they await extraction. They soon find themselves at the center of an ambush as the drug lord's former associates launch an explosive assault on the hotel.

Box Office Collection: Killing Salazar
| Metric / Region | Collection (Approx) |
|---|---|
| Production Budget | $7.0M |
| Worldwide Gross | $37.8K |
| Trade Verdict | FINANCIAL DISAPPOINTMENT |
